FROM ubuntu:latest MAINTAINER Elbert Alias ENV DEBIAN_FRONTEND noninteractive ENV WAPPALYZER_ROOT /usr/local/wappalyzer RUN sed -i 's/archive\.ubuntu\.com/au.archive.ubuntu.com/g' /etc/apt/sources.list RUN \ apt-get update && apt-get install -y \ libfreetype6 \ libfontconfig \ nodejs \ npm \ && apt-get clean && r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/* RUN ln -s $(which nodejs) /usr/bin/node RUN mkdir "$WAPPALYZER_ROOT" WORKDIR "$WAPPALYZER_ROOT" ADD apps.json . ADD driver.js . ADD index.js . ADD package.json . ADD wappalyzer.js . RUN npm i ENTRYPOINT ["node", "index.js"]